在这个数字化时代,编程已经成为一种基础技能。让孩子从小就接触编程,不仅能够激发他们的创新思维,还能为他们的未来打下坚实的基础。那么,如何让孩子从零基础开始学习编程,并最终创作出属于自己的游戏呢?以下是一些轻松入门的秘诀。
第一课:了解编程的基本概念
在开始编程之前,首先要让孩子了解编程的基本概念,比如什么是编程、编程语言、计算机程序等。可以通过以下方式让孩子对编程有一个初步的认识:
- 故事引入:通过讲述一些编程小故事,如《小猫学编程》等,让孩子在故事中了解编程。
- 互动游戏:利用一些编程启蒙游戏,如Scratch、Code.org等,让孩子在游戏中感受编程的乐趣。
- 动画视频:观看一些适合孩子的编程动画视频,如《极客少年》等,让孩子在轻松愉快的氛围中学习编程知识。
第二课:选择合适的编程语言
对于初学者来说,选择一门易于上手、功能丰富的编程语言非常重要。以下是一些适合孩子学习的编程语言:
- Scratch:这是一款专为儿童设计的图形化编程语言,通过拖拽积木块的方式完成编程,非常适合入门。
- Python:Python语言简单易学,语法清晰,广泛应用于Web开发、数据分析、人工智能等领域。
- ScratchJr:这是Scratch的简化版,更适合幼儿园及小学低年级的孩子。
第三课:动手实践,创作游戏
当孩子掌握了基本的编程知识后,就可以开始创作自己的游戏了。以下是一些创作游戏的方法:
- 模仿经典:让孩子先模仿一些经典的编程游戏,如《愤怒的小鸟》、《植物大战僵尸》等,了解游戏开发的基本流程。
- 自主创意:鼓励孩子发挥自己的想象力,创作属于自己的游戏。可以从简单的游戏开始,逐步增加难度。
- 参考教程:在网上可以找到很多关于编程游戏的教程,让孩子按照教程一步步学习,逐步提高自己的编程技能。
第四课:分享与展示
当孩子完成自己的游戏后,鼓励他们分享和展示自己的作品。可以通过以下方式:
- 家庭聚会:在家庭聚会上,让孩子向亲朋好友展示自己的游戏,获得认可和鼓励。
- 编程比赛:参加一些编程比赛,让孩子在比赛中锻炼自己的编程能力。
- 线上平台:将游戏上传到线上平台,如Scratch官网、Twitch等,让更多人了解和体验自己的作品。
总结
让孩子从零基础学习编程,并最终创作出属于自己的游戏,需要耐心和指导。通过了解编程的基本概念、选择合适的编程语言、动手实践、分享与展示,孩子可以逐步掌握编程技能,开启属于自己的编程之旅。在这个过程中,家长的陪伴和鼓励至关重要。相信只要孩子保持热爱,他们一定能够成为一名优秀的程序员!
